Transportation from the City Center to Hannover Airport
Hannover, the capital of the German state of Lower Saxony, is also the country's largest fair city. Hannover, which is a city with a very active economy, hosts tens of thousands of visitors every year as it has developed in areas such as tourism and trade. Hannover Langenhagen International Airport connects the city to the world.
The distance between Hannover city center and Hannover Airport is 11 km. You can use train, bus, taxi and car rental options to reach Hannover Airport from the city center.
Trains are one of the most economical methods of transportation from the city center to the airport. S-Bahn trains running on the S5 line in the city reach the airport. Transportation takes 20 minutes on average by trains, which run at intervals of 30 minutes 7 days a week.
Bus number 470 departing from Langenhagen is among the public transportation options to reach the airport. You can take this bus to the Airport Terminal C.
It is possible to reach the airport in a short time by taxis from different points of the city. The route between the city center and the airport takes about 20 minutes by taxi.
You can also provide transportation by renting a car from rent a car offices in the city or through online reservation.

Transportation from Lagos Murtala Muhammed International Airport to the City Center
Lagos, the capital of Nigeria, is one of the fastest developing settlements in West Africa. The city of Lagos, which also hosts Lagos Murtala Muhammed International Airport, was used by the Portuguese for the slave trade in the 15th century. Today, Lagos, known for its beaches, museums and historical spots, is one of the most vibrant cities on the continent.
You can reach the city center from Lagos Murtala Muhammed International Airport, located 22 kilometers northwest of Lagos, by using taxi and transfer buses or by renting a car. This journey between the airport and the city center can take between 30-60 minutes depending on the traffic situation.
Lagos is a city with a high traffic density, so those who are considering renting a car should calculate their journey times well to avoid delays. In this city, which is also known for its high crime rate, it is also important not to leave valuables in the vehicle and to keep your doors locked in traffic.
Also, many hotels in Lagos provide transfer buses for their guests to travel between the airport and the city centre. Do not forget that you have the chance to benefit from this service by contacting the hotel official.
Taxis, which are a comfortable and reliable transportation option, are also very popular among the passengers coming to the city. Before getting on the taxis waiting in front of the terminal building, do not forget to negotiate the fare.
